Problem

Existing display systems risk unintentional leakage of sensitive display content when shared between devices due to lack of operating system-specific display format configuration.

Innovation Solution

A display system that determines the operating system type of a first device and configures a selectable display format with a transmitter, allowing users to select and control the display mode based on the OS type, preventing unintended content sharing.

AI summary

A display system includes a determination processing unit that determines a type of an operating system installed in a user terminal when a transmitter is connected to the user terminal, and a configuration processing unit that configures a display format of each of the user terminal and a display in a selectable state based on the type of the operating system.
